Strictly Come Dancing champion Ellie Leach has recalled a rather mucousy final week on the show.

Following her and professional partner Vito Coppola's victory in the BBC ballroom - they beat finalists Bobby Brazier and Dianne Buswell, and Layton Williams and Nikita Kuzmin to the Glitterball trophy - the duo set up an Instagram livestream to reflect on their wonderful adventure together.

Asked by a fan if there were any particularly embarrassing moments shared between them, Leach and Coppola couldn't help but chuckle over the time they came down with colds during the business end of the competition.

The former Coronation Street actress replied: "In the final week we were quite ill, we both had colds, we were both bunged up.

"In the show dance there was lots of twists and turns and when I turned, I snotted all over me."

Apparently, her snottiness ended up distracting Leach from focussing on the task in hand, much to the frustration of Coppola, who could be seen smirking throughout this anecdote.

Meanwhile, the Strictly winners finally laid those romance rumours to bed earlier this week.

"Honestly, we've just been having the most amazing time dancing. We've built a really strong bond and a friendship that will last forever," Leach told This Morning presenter Josie Gibson.

Coppola chipped in with: "We had a beautiful bond. You see a person and you connect straight away - I'm very first impression person and when we met we had that feeling that we knew each other since we were young. You choose the people and I'm so, so lucky to have you in my life."

"We've been through so much together, we've spent every day together for the past three months, so we're really lucky to just have that bond that we've got, we'll be friends for life," reiterated his dance partner.
